I need a bad Christmas movie to review for our annual greeting issue. In past years, I've done Santa Claus Conquers the Martians, Mexican Santa Claus, The Star Wars Holiday Special and Santa with Muscles. I need something as cheesy as these.

Any suggestions?

THE CHRISTMAS THAT ALMOST WASN'T.

I saw it at the movies when I was a kid.  I just bought the DVD a few weeks ago.

It's about an evil landlord who is trying to throw Santa out of his house for not paying his rent.  Rosanno Brazzi plays the villain.  It's dubbed, trashy fun.
